直到现在我才意识到这一点(而且这不仅出现在 webkit 浏览器中)。p
标签,h1
标签等…文本上方和下方有一个额外的空格。
在 Chrome 中我发现了这个:
用户代理样式表
-webkit-margin-before: 1em;
-webkit-margin-after: 1em;
-webkit-margin-start: 0px;
-webkit-margin-end: 0px;
这使得某些地方的对齐错误。
答案
您还可以直接修改这些属性,如下所示:
-webkit-margin-before:0em;
-webkit-margin-after:0em;
在 Chrome/Safari 中适用于我。